PHP批量查询WordPress留言者E-mail地址实现方法


Posted in PHP onFebruary 15, 2015

今天收到了很多Bloger朋友的E-mail拜年短信,嘿嘿,感觉很好玩,可是他们是如何实现的这个呢,很简单的,可是简单的分为两步:

1)通过SQL查询获取E-mail地址

2)通过某种方法群发E-mail

对于1,几行PHP代码可以解决: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html

xmlns="http://www.w3.org/1999/xhtml">

<head>

<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/>

<title>WordPress 邮件群发工具 Designed By Kaisir</title>

</head>

<body>

<?php

//要连接的数据库地址

$db_server="localhost";

//数据库用户名

$db_user_name="这里改成你的数据库用户名";

//数据库密码

$db_user_password="这里改成你的数据库的密码";

//数据库名

$db_name="这里改成你的数据库名";

//以下代码请不要修改

$sql="SELECT DISTINCT comment_author_email FROM `blog_comments` WHERE 1";

$conn=mysql_connect($db_server,$db_user_name,$db_user_password);

if(!$conn)

{

 echo"<p align=center>数据库连接失败!请检查用户名密码!</p>";

 exit(0);

}

$flag=mysql_select_db($db_name,$conn);

if(!$flag)

{

 echo"<p align=center>数据库连接正常,但无法打开指定的数据库!</p>";

 exit(0);

}

//执行查询

$result=mysql_query($sql,$conn);

while($row=mysql_fetch_array($result))

{

?>

<?echo $row["comment_author_email"]?>,

<?php

}

mysql_close($conn);//关闭数据库连接

?>

</body>

</html>

对于2,这个就比较麻烦了……因为那么大数据量的邮件任何一个邮件服务商都会把你屏蔽掉的,所以最好的办法就是自己搭建SMTP服务器,或者使用群发工具,嘿嘿,这个就由大家自己Google好了啦 :)

PHP 相关文章推荐
Zend引擎的发展 [15]
Oct 09 PHP
第十一节 重载 [11]
Oct 09 PHP
站长助手-网站web在线管理程序 v1.0 下载
May 12 PHP
snoopy 强大的PHP采集类使用实例代码
Dec 09 PHP
php删除页面记录 同时刷新页面 删除条件用GET方式获得
Jan 10 PHP
解析php开发中的中文编码问题
Aug 08 PHP
单台服务器的PHP进程之间实现共享内存的方法
Jun 13 PHP
Thinkphp中的volist标签用法简介
Jun 18 PHP
CodeIgniter模板引擎使用实例
Jul 15 PHP
php自定义错误处理用法实例
Mar 20 PHP
PHP连接Nginx服务器并解析Nginx日志的方法
Aug 16 PHP
PHP中strnatcmp()函数“自然排序算法”进行字符串比较用法分析(对比strcmp函数)
Jan 07 PHP
CentOS下PHP安装Oracle扩展
Feb 15 #PHP
PHPExcel读取EXCEL中的图片并保存到本地的方法
Feb 14 #PHP
php魔术函数__call()用法实例分析
Feb 13 #PHP
PHP中使用file_get_contents post数据代码例子
Feb 13 #PHP
PHP网站开发中常用的8个小技巧
Feb 13 #PHP
用php守护另一个php进程的例子
Feb 13 #PHP
cakephp打印sql语句的方法
Feb 13 #PHP
You might like
解析PHP提交后跳转
2013/06/23 PHP
解决PhpMyAdmin中导入2M以上大文件限制的方法分享
2014/06/06 PHP
PHP如何通过AJAX方式实现登录功能
2015/11/23 PHP
PHP 年月日的三级联动实例代码
2017/05/24 PHP
JavaScript高级程序设计 阅读笔记(十四) js继承机制的实现
2012/08/14 Javascript
node.js中的require使用详解
2014/12/15 Javascript
javascript iframe跨域详解
2016/10/26 Javascript
jquery获取table指定行和列的数据方法(当前选中行、列)
2016/11/07 Javascript
JavaScript字符串对象(string)基本用法示例
2017/01/18 Javascript
B/S(Web)实时通讯解决方案分享
2017/04/06 Javascript
jQuery中map函数的两种方式
2017/04/07 jQuery
微信小程序 flex实现导航实例详解
2017/04/26 Javascript
jquery实现用户登陆界面(示例讲解)
2017/09/06 jQuery
javascript实现获取一个日期段内每天不同的价格(计算入住总价格)
2018/02/05 Javascript
深入浅出理解JavaScript闭包的功能与用法
2018/08/01 Javascript
微信小程序列表中item左滑删除功能
2018/11/07 Javascript
js实现搜索栏效果
2018/11/16 Javascript
详解CommonJS和ES6模块循环加载处理的区别
2018/12/26 Javascript
vue响应式更新机制及不使用框架实现简单的数据双向绑定问题
2019/06/27 Javascript
JS 遍历 json 和 JQuery 遍历json操作完整示例
2019/11/11 jQuery
vue cli 3.0通用打包配置代码,不分一二级目录
2020/09/02 Javascript
python在OpenCV里实现投影变换效果
2019/08/30 Python
关于python 的legend图例,参数使用说明
2020/04/17 Python
Python批量获取并保存手机号归属地和运营商的示例
2020/10/09 Python
python 模拟登陆github的示例
2020/12/04 Python
CSS3图片旋转特效(360/60/-360度)
2013/10/10 HTML / CSS
html5给汉字加拼音加进度条的实现代码
2020/04/07 HTML / CSS
HTML5 背景的显示区域实现
2020/07/09 HTML / CSS
2014年中班元旦活动方案
2014/02/14 职场文书
激励口号大全
2014/06/17 职场文书
优秀共产党员演讲稿
2014/09/04 职场文书
保密工作整改报告
2014/11/06 职场文书
2014年督导工作总结
2014/11/19 职场文书
英文感谢信范文
2015/01/21 职场文书
如何起草一份正确的合伙创业协议书?
2019/07/04 职场文书
《鲁滨逊漂流记》之六读后感(4篇)
2019/09/29 职场文书